    With the freezing temperatures, we had a water line burst and flood our furnace. I called Chapman…read moreand they scheduled us for both repairs the same day. The furnace tech diagnosed the furnace as needing at least a new control board and couldn't be sure other parts weren't bad. The furnace was full of ice. Based on the price of the potential repairs, it made more sense to replace the furnace. The installers arrived first thing the next morning and we had heat around lunch time. Everyone from Chapman was clean, courteous and did great work. It wasn't cheap for any of this, but we feel that the prices were reasonable, especially since we were 100% done the very next day.

    Because I had purchased a furnace from Plumbing and Heating Paramedics and received excellent…read moreservice and a fair price, they were first on my list when I found an outdoor water faucet frozen after the winter's cold weather. A technician came out and inspected it. He said he needed to turn water off to the whole house but probably would run into a problem with the shut off valve, and recommended that be replaced also. The total bill was going to be almost $1000. I wanted to think about it so paid him $85 for a service call and told him I would get back to him in a few days. In the meantime I spoke with a friend who has some plumbing knowledge and he told me how to make the repair. I didn't need to shut off the water at all. It cost me less than $6 and took about 5 minutes. I definitely feel I this technician was trying to swindle me. I called the owner and asked to speak with him to give him a chance to rectify the situation, but after leaving a message because he wasn't available never got a return call. I would avoid these people because now I sincerely questioned their honesty and/or competency.
